IAS officer Shashank Goel’s son shot dead in Istanbul

Senior IAS officer Shashank Goel’s son Shubham Goel was reportedly shot dead by a group of armed robbers in Istanbul of Turkey on May 24. He was on a holiday with his friend Sudhanshu, a native of Noida.

Shubham’s mortal remains were brought to New Delhi on Saturday and were taken to Roorkee in Uttarakhand where the last rites were performed on Sunday.

Mr Goel rushed to New Delhi after learning of his son’s death and officials of the External Affairs Ministry assisted him in transporting the body to India.

Shubham came to India on April 28 to attend a family wedding and on his way back to California, USA, he made a quick holiday plan to Turkey with his friend, said an IAS officer, who spoke to Mr Goel over the phone on Sunday evening.

Shubham, who completed his graduation from Amity University in Noida, was working as Deputy Manager at Federal Bank of America, the official said.

Mr Goel told the officer that on April 24, a group of robbers confronted Shubham and his friend Sudhanshu and demanded cash and other valuables they were carrying.

“When the boy refused to meet their demands, the gang stabbed and shot him, resulting in his instant death,” the officer said, seeking anonymity.

Mr Goel is principal secretary (labour) to the Telangana government.
